Keep all parts clean from contaminants. Contaminants put into the system may cause rapid wear and shortened component life. |
1. Turn the crankshaft until two of the pistons are at bottom center. Remove two rod cap bolts (1) from each rod. Remove rod caps (2).
2. Using a soft hammer, tape rod (3) away from crankshaft and remove bearing half (4).
3. Use Tool (A) to remove cylinder liners (6).
4. Remove piston and connecting rods from the cylinder liners.
Install Cylinder Liners
Cylinder Liner Projection
NOTE: This procedure alleviates the need for the "H" bar to hold liners during projection measurements.
1. Install clean liners or cylinder packs (without the filler band or the rubber seals), spacer plate gasket and clean spacer plate.
2. Install bolts and washers, as indicated above, in the holes indicated with an X. Install all bolts or the six bolts around the liner. Tighten the bolts to a torque of 95 N·m (70 lb ft).
3. Use Tool (B) to measure the liner projection at four positions. Place tool next to each hold down bolt and record the measurement. Record measurements for each of the four cylinders and divide by four to find the average.
4. If the liner projections are out of specification, try rotating the liner or install the liner in another bore to see if the measurements improve.
5. Do not exceed the maximum liner projection of 0.175 mm (.0069 in). Excessive liner projection will contribute to liner flange cracking.
6. With the proper liner projection, mark the liners in the proper position and set them aside.
7. When the engine is ready for final assembly, the O-ring seals, cylinder liner block and upper filler band must be lubricated before installation.
8. If the lower O-rings are black in color, apply liquid soap on the lower O-ring seals and the cylinder block. Use clean engine oil on the upper filler band.
9. If the lower O-rings are brown in color, apply clean engine oil on the lower O-ring seals, the cylinder block and the upper filler band.
NOTE: Apply liquid soap and/or clean engine oil immediately before assembly. If applied too early, the filler bands may swell and be pinched under the liners during installation.
10. Put liquid soap on bottom liner bore in block, on grooves in lower liner and on O-ring seals on the liner.
11. Put filler band (5) in clean SAE 30 oil for a moment and install on liner. Install cylinder pack immediately in the cylinder block (before expansion of filler band).
Typical Example
12. Make sure the mark on liner is in alignment with the mark on the block. Use Tooling (A) to push the liner into position.
13. Repeat Steps 1 through 3 for the remainder of the cylinder liners.
14. Install the pistons and connecting rods. Refer to the topic "Pistons & Connecting Rods" in this manual.
